Abstractations Show Opens at Raleigh City Museum

The Raleigh City Museum put out a call for entries for its newest exhibit, Abstractations: Capital City Inspirations and Observations, a few months ago inviting artists to submit a piece in any medium that was abstractly inspired by the interacting with Raleigh. The result is a multi-media show juried by Sarah Powers which includes paintings, mixed media, sculpture, and even audio by the following artists:

David Mueller of Birds of Avalon submitted a 4 song musical piece, one of which you can listen to here.

If you are a member of the Raleigh City Museum, there is a special member preview party tonight, October 1 from 5:30-7:00. There will be live music by the Stray Dogs, and beer courtesy of the Busy Bee Cafe. Not a member?  You can join at the door.

The public opening reception is Friday, October 2 from 6:00-9:00, and will have drinks, free food courtesy of the Duck & Dumpling and live music by the Salty Dogs.
